This radiator features a 2-Row core with CSF's exclusive B-Tube Technology: Unlike a regular oval shape "O" type radiator tube, CSF uses a specially engineered tube in the shape of a "B". These "B-tubes" are carefully formed and then brazed over the seam to seal. CSF is able to use thinner and lighter aluminum material (with better cooling efficiency) because this design is actually stronger than normal "O" shape tubes that are welded. The design (inlet in the middle of the tube that is seam brazed) increases the heat transfer surface area of the tubes by approximately 15% over regular tubes - producing the efficiency of two smaller tubes vs. one large tube within the same space criteria. With "B-tubes" you are able to get "dual liquid laminar flow". CSF also uses ultra efficient multi louvered fins that are carefully and precisely aligned to maximize airflow through each radiator core. The unique design of CSF's oil cooler line has distinct advantages over conventional style oil coolers (plate-type/stacked oil coolers). The oil coolers can be placed in tighter spaces or different areas of the vehicle that don't have much vertical surface area. Longer rectangular sizes can also help with avoiding the stacking of too many coolers which may cause airflow issues to other components in the cooling system. Inlet/outlet port placement is much easier to route oil lines. Typical oil cooler lines have to be routed from different/opposite ends of the cooler often facing up or down. Usually one line has to run across from one side of the cooler to the other to then be routed together to the feed/return connection of the oil system. The CSF oil coolers are much more robust, durable, and can withstand a higher peak burst rate. This allows the cooler to be mounted in areas that might get high debris (front fascia, diff cooler, side vents, etc...). The CSF oil cooler is designed to withstand a tremendous amount of vibration and debris.
